Ticket: DocSweep linter keeps failing in staging

So the staging box for DocSweep was running with a half-copied env file — the style-rules fetcher can't auth against the rules registry, and every lint run dies with a 401. Non-secret vars are already fixed. Last piece: the registry token needs to go back into `.env`, one line, like this:

sealed setting: LEDGER_TOKEN5=bcca1

Handover — DeployBot. The bot (Pinglet) posts deploy status to the #ships channel. Config lives in the orbit repo; restart via the supervisor panel. Rotation of its token is monthly; Marisol handled it last. If Pinglet loses its session, re-seed it with the recovery passphrase printed below.

recovery phrase for fajep-yaweg: gilath-sorox-wenius-rusdor-keliel-zorius

Subject: Partner SFTP drop cut-over summary

Hello,

As of this morning, the Greyfen partner drop has fully moved to the new Oakhollow SFTP host. All inbound files land in the standard intake path, are checksummed on arrival, and archived after processing. The old host rejects new connections but retains thirty days of history.

For your onboarding, the current service configuration is provided below.

deployment values, yadug-bawif:
[framir]
team = pelox
access_code = ac_a38ab2
owner = tamion.julael
host = framir.tolvaqlabs.test
port = 11211
peer = tammir.zemvargrid.local
salt = 2215ef03
pin = 1541